The Heartbeat

The thirst inside consumes me
as each day starts anew.
Satisfied just hours before
with the blood of just a few.

Hiding in the darkness
as the world comes to life.
The light I haven't seen
cuts through me like a knife.

As the light begins to fade,
the drive inside begins.
I feel the heartbeat of them all
as teeth sink deep within.

Slipping through the darkness,
unknown among mere men,
no one knowing who I am
or where my thoughts have been.

Each one that is chosen,
I sense the escence of their soul.
Each one that I've taken
brings me closer to being whole.

They all hope for eternity.
A place they long to be,
but after I have slipped inside
their eternity's with me.

So keep a watchful eye
each and every place you go,
cause' I can feel your heartbeat now,
and smell the escence of your soul!
